Caption: A Mexican ox-cart hauling wood
Additional Description: Mexican carts, supposedly introduced by Sebastián Aparicio in the late 1500s, probably looked similar to this image from around 1880. Prior to the arrival of the Spanish there were no large draft animals in Mesoamerica, so a cart would not have been practical. (Courtesy Library of Congress at loc.gov).
